Ultra-Luxury Retreat
The Luxury of Space & Privacy
Opened in 2015, the Retreat is situated on a secluded hillside, 150 meters west of the Hideaway. During the G7 summits in 2015 and 2022, the property served as a residence for heads of state and government.
The retreat features 47 exceptionally spacious rooms and suites (55–200 m²), all equipped with silent, inductive cooling. It also offers an adults-only spa with a Japanese onsen, a family spa, a fitness center, a yoga pavilion, a library lounge, and four restaurants serving Mediterranean and Japanese cuisine. In every room, the cosmopolitan interior and lighting design artfully combines Asian lightness, timeless Italian elegance, and fine, natural materials from around the world with breathtaking views of the Wetterstein Mountains and the rushing Ferchenbach stream.
The Retreat is the perfect choice for guests who appreciate a hotel that is both intimate and vast—nestled in a dreamlike setting where they can completely unwind and experience unspoiled nature. Guests at the Retreat also have access to all the amenities of the Hideaway.
The Hideaway
The Luxury of Space and Possibilities
Built in 1916, this historic retreat—a designated historic landmark—was largely destroyed by a major fire in 2005. It was rebuilt in 2007 on a grander scale and reopened as a Luxury Spa & Cultural Hideaway and a proud member of Leading Hotels of the World.
The resort offers countless opportunities to meet interesting people from all over the world or simply to unwind completely. It features 100 spacious rooms and suites (25 to 110 m²), two adult-only spas, two family-friendly spas, a TCM Medical Spa, a Jivamukti Yoga Center, a sports center, a fitness studio, a tea lounge, and a jazz piano bar. The property also includes a concert hall, a bookstore, two libraries, and five restaurants, including the two-Michelin-starred French-Japanese fusion restaurant Ikigai.
Artists particularly appreciate the Hideaway for its proximity to the concert hall, while families love the easy access to the family restaurant, the family tea lounge, the Kids Club, and the family spa. With the exception of breakfast, guests at the Hideaway are welcome to enjoy all the amenities of the Retreat.
